    Hello and welcome.

    Cents in the 1990s typically came in 2 different types. The "Wide AM" cents from 1990-1992, and the "Close AM" cents from 1993-1999. You can best tell the difference between the two here: http://lincolncentresource.com/wideams.html

    For the 1990s, there are a few coins that are seen as "rare". They are the 1992 with a "Close AM" reverse, and 1998, 1999, and 2000 with a "Wide AM" reverse. Again, check out the link I posted, and it will show you the difference and have a list of the rare ones. Hope this helps!
